At Home Insemination: A Budget-Smart Plan Amid the Noise
Before you try at home insemination, run this quick checklist: Timing plan: You know how you’ll identify ovulation (OPKs, cervical mucus, BBT, or a combo). Supplies: Sterile syringe/applicator, collection cup (if needed), clean surface, and a simple cleanup plan. Sperm logistics: Fresh vs. frozen, thaw/transport rules, and a backup plan if timing shifts. Donor screening:…

At Home Insemination Today: Safer Choices, Clearer Rights
Before you try at home insemination, run this quick checklist: Timing: Do you know your likely fertile window (OPKs, cervical mucus, or BBT)? Screening: Have you planned STI testing and basic health info sharing? Supplies: Do you have sterile, single-use tools made for insemination? Consent: Is everyone clear on roles, boundaries, and expectations? Paper trail:…

At Home Insemination: A Checklist for Real-Life ICI Talk
Before you try at home insemination, run this quick checklist: Timing plan: you have a way to estimate ovulation (LH strips, cervical mucus tracking, or a fertility app). Supplies ready: needle-free syringe, clean collection cup, towels, pads, and a timer. Comfort setup: pillows, privacy, and a low-stress window where you won’t be rushed. Safety basics:…
